How to Say "innovation" in Spanish
The Spanish word for “innovation” is “novedad” — B1 level. This is a very common word in everyday Spanish.
English → SpanishB1
nounB1
a new feature or invention

Examples
La tienda presentó sus novedades de verano.
The store presented its summer novelties (new products).
El diseño de este edificio es una gran novedad arquitectónica.
The design of this building is a great architectural innovation.
Perdió la novedad al cabo de unos meses.
It lost its novelty after a few months.
Use with 'Buscar'
When you are actively searching for new things, you often use 'buscar novedades' (to look for new products or innovations) in the plural.
